Abstract

Use of cyclodextrin for manufacturing a composition for inhibiting growth of oral bacteria is provided in the disclosure, and cyclodextrin is maintained in the oral cavity for a specific time period for inhibiting growth of oral bacteria. The growth of oral bacteria is inhibited by cyclodextrin without the use of high irritating sanitizer and organic solvent, and the formation of antibiotic resistance can be prevented. Use of cyclodextrin for manufacturing a composition for inhibiting plaque, acid etching, calculus or improving gum diseases is further provided in the disclosure.

本揭示內容是有關於環糊精針對口腔護理的用途,且特別是有關於環糊精抑制口腔細菌生長的用途。The present disclosure relates to the use of cyclodextrins for oral care, and in particular to the use of cyclodextrins to inhibit the growth of oral bacteria.

口腔是一個複雜而完整的微生態系統,透過微生物、微生物代謝物、口腔與口腔分泌物之間的交互作用形成的生物膜,為各種微生物的生長繁殖提供了適宜的環境和條件。研究指出若干口腔疾病,例如齲齒、結石、牙周病、牙齦炎等的發生,都與生長於口腔生物膜的有害細菌的繁殖有關。若能抑制有害細菌在口腔中大量生長,可避免並改善口腔疾病。The oral cavity is a complex and complete microbial ecosystem. The biofilm formed by the interaction between microorganisms, microbial metabolites, and oral cavity and oral secretions provides suitable environment and conditions for the growth and reproduction of various microorganisms. Studies have pointed out that the occurrence of several oral diseases, such as dental caries, calculus, periodontal disease, and gingivitis, are related to the reproduction of harmful bacteria that grow in oral biofilms. If you can inhibit the large growth of harmful bacteria in the mouth, oral diseases can be avoided and improved.

目前,對於口腔有害細菌的控制,主要依靠廣譜化學殺菌劑、抗生素等方法。然而,因廣譜化學殺菌劑、抗生素,具有高度刺激性,長期使用會造成口腔細菌大量死亡或引發細菌耐藥性,使口腔菌群失調,甚至造成口腔細胞變異,引發其它疾病。此外,由於廣譜化學殺菌劑或抗生素往往需以有機溶液(例如酒精)作為溶劑,使用時還會有破壞口腔黏膜的風險。At present, the control of oral harmful bacteria mainly relies on broad-spectrum chemical fungicides, antibiotics and other methods. However, because broad-spectrum chemical fungicides and antibiotics are highly irritating, long-term use will cause a large number of oral bacteria to die or cause bacterial resistance, make oral flora imbalance, and even cause oral cell mutation, causing other diseases. In addition, since broad-spectrum chemical fungicides or antibiotics often require organic solutions (such as alcohol) as solvents, there is a risk of damaging the oral mucosa when used.

因此,如何提供溫和、安全、具有抑菌功效又不會產生抗藥性的口腔抑菌劑,是待解決的問題。Therefore, how to provide an oral bacteriostatic agent that is mild, safe, has bacteriostatic effect and does not produce drug resistance is a problem to be solved.

於本文中,「生物膜」意指,嵌在細菌和唾液來源之聚合物基質中的牙齒表面或牙周表面上的各種微生物群落,生物膜的形成涉及較早細菌聚落和此薄膜間的相互作用。隨後,第二菌落附著至已黏附的早期菌落(共聚集)且此過程使得成熟的生物膜生成。抑制生物膜的生長可防止和減少細菌再附著至牙齒表面或牙周表面。As used herein, "biofilm" means the various microbial communities on the tooth or periodontal surface embedded in a polymer matrix of bacterial and saliva origin. The formation of biofilms involves earlier bacterial colonies and interactions between this film. effect. Subsequently, a second colony attaches to the already adherent early colonies (coaggregation) and this process allows the formation of mature biofilms. Inhibition of biofilm growth prevents and reduces bacterial reattachment to tooth or periodontal surfaces.

舉例而言,牙菌斑是多種口腔細菌組成的生物膜,以三維結構黏附在牙齒表面,複雜的結構使它能包涵對氧有不同敏感性的細菌,這些細菌嵌入在由多糖、蛋白質和礦物質組成的聚合物基質中生長、發育和衰亡。牙菌斑中的某些細菌,會產生代謝物酸蝕牙釉質或牙齦,導致蛀牙或敏感性牙齒,或是產生菌斑沉積在牙齒上,導致結石…等症狀,是牙齦疾病 (例如牙齦炎或牙周炎)的主要致病因素。For example, dental plaque is a biofilm composed of a variety of oral bacteria that adhere to the tooth surface in a three-dimensional structure. The complex structure enables it to contain bacteria with different sensitivities to oxygen. Growth, development and decay in a polymer matrix of matter. Certain bacteria in dental plaque can produce metabolites that erode tooth enamel or gums, causing tooth decay or sensitive teeth, or produce plaque deposits on teeth, leading to calculus... symptoms such as gum disease (such as gingivitis) or periodontitis).

在本揭示內容的一些實施方式中,提供環糊精(cyclodextrin;CD)用於抑制口腔細菌的用途,包含維持環糊精於口腔中特定時間。在一些實施方式中,口腔細菌包括但不限於鏈球菌屬 ( Streptococcus)、嗜血桿菌屬 ( Haemophilus)、放線菌屬 ( Actinomyces)、雷沃氏菌屬 ( Prevotella)、大腸桿菌屬 ( Escherichia)、或葡萄球菌屬 ( Staphylococcus)。在一些實施方式中,特定時間包含0.5至10分鐘。在一實施方式中,至少0.5分鐘、1分鐘、5分鐘、10分鐘、30分鐘、1小時、2小時、3小時、4小時、5小時、6小時或前述任意間隔之時間,可達到抑制口腔細菌生長的效果。在一些實施方式中,抑制口腔細菌可包含抑制口腔中的細菌形成生物膜。 In some embodiments of the present disclosure, the use of a cyclodextrin (CD) for inhibiting oral bacteria is provided, comprising maintaining the cyclodextrin in the oral cavity for a specified time. In some embodiments, oral bacteria include, but are not limited to, Streptococcus , Haemophilus , Actinomyces , Prevotella , Escherichia , or Staphylococcus . In some embodiments, the specified time comprises 0.5 to 10 minutes. In one embodiment, at least 0.5 minutes, 1 minute, 5 minutes, 10 minutes, 30 minutes, 1 hour, 2 hours, 3 hours, 4 hours, 5 hours, 6 hours, or any interval of the foregoing, can achieve oral inhibition effect on bacterial growth. In some embodiments, inhibiting oral bacteria can comprise inhibiting bacteria in the oral cavity from forming a biofilm.

環糊精為不飽和六元雜環化合物,對人體無害,口感溫和無刺激性,並具有疏水性內腔以及親水性外殼的兩性分子特點,內腔可作為包涵體,容納多種疏水性分子,以往多見於助溶、固定分子、輸送藥物、除臭等用途。值得注意的是,本揭示內容中的一些實施方式利用環糊精的兩性結構特性,包覆口腔細菌產生的代謝物,避免細菌生物膜的形成,首度將環糊精用於抑制口腔細胞的生長。在一些實施方式中,環糊精包括ɑ-環糊精、β-環糊精、γ-環糊精、δ-環糊精、或其衍伸物之其中一種或多種,不同環糊精具有不同的疏水性分子包覆能力以及水溶性,可根據需求選用適當的環糊精。舉例而言,羥丙基-β-環糊精 (h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in;HP-β-CD)由β-環糊精修飾而成,不僅便宜並且來源廣泛易於取得,具有優異的水溶性,可直接以水配置為漱口水,使用上不僅成本低且並具有高度便利性。Cyclodextrin is an unsaturated six-membered heterocyclic compound, which is harmless to the human body, has a mild and non-irritating taste, and has the characteristics of amphiphilic molecules with a hydrophobic inner cavity and a hydrophilic shell. The inner cavity can be used as an inclusion body to accommodate a variety of hydrophobic molecules. In the past, it was more common in solubilization, molecular fixation, drug delivery, deodorization and other purposes. It is worth noting that some embodiments of the present disclosure utilize the amphiphilic structural properties of cyclodextrins to coat metabolites produced by oral bacteria and avoid the formation of bacterial biofilms. Cyclodextrins are used for the first time to inhibit the growth of oral cells. grow. In some embodiments, the cyclodextrin includes one or more of α-cyclodextrin, β-cyclodextrin, γ-cyclodextrin, δ-cyclodextrin, or derivatives thereof, and different cyclodextrins have Different hydrophobic molecular coating ability and water solubility, the appropriate cyclodextrin can be selected according to the needs. For example, h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in (HP-β-CD) is modified by β-cyclodextrin, which is not only cheap but also widely available and has excellent water solubility. It can be directly configured with water as mouthwash, which is not only low-cost but also highly convenient to use.

在一些實施方式中,組合物可以包含於口腔護理用品中。在一實施方式中,環糊精在口腔護理用品中的重量百分比為0.1%至1.5%,例如0.1%、0.2%、0.3%、0.4%、0.5%、0.6%、0.7%、0.8%、0.9%、1.0%、1.1%、1.2%、1.3%、1.4%、1.5%、或前述任意間距的重量百分比。環糊精濃度過高或過低均無法達成抑制細菌生長的效果,濃度過高反而會使部分細菌(例如肺炎克雷伯氏菌)生長,濃度過低則效果不彰。In some embodiments, the composition may be included in an oral care implement. In one embodiment, the weight percent of cyclodextrin in the oral care product is 0.1% to 1.5%, such as 0.1%, 0.2%, 0.3%, 0.4%, 0.5%, 0.6%, 0.7%, 0.8%, 0.9 %, 1.0%, 1.1%, 1.2%, 1.3%, 1.4%, 1.5%, or a weight percent of any of the foregoing spacings. Too high or too low concentration of cyclodextrin cannot achieve the effect of inhibiting the growth of bacteria. If the concentration is too high, some bacteria (such as Klebsiella pneumoniae) will grow. If the concentration is too low, the effect will be ineffective.

實施例一、環糊精的抑菌試驗Embodiment 1, the antibacterial test of cyclodextrin

為測試環糊精對於口腔細菌的抑制性,將不同作用濃度的羥丙基-β-環糊精 (重量百分比包含0.1%、1%、以及10%)分別與的肺炎雷伯氏菌( Klebsiella pneumoniae)、金黃色葡萄球菌 ( Staphylococcus aureus)、以及大腸桿菌 ( Escherichia coli)混合作用特定時間 (1分鐘以及6小時),其中各組細菌的初始反應濃度為1x10 5cfu/mL ,檢測各組細菌在單位體積下的菌落數,將結果繪製為第1A圖至第1C圖。 In order to test the inhibitory effect of cyclodextrin on oral bacteria, different concentrations of h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in (including 0.1%, 1%, and 10% by weight) were mixed with Klebsiella pneumoniae. pneumoniae ), Staphylococcus aureus , and Escherichia coli were mixed for a specific time (1 minute and 6 hours), wherein the initial reaction concentration of each group of bacteria was 1×10 5 cfu/mL, and each group of bacteria was detected The number of colonies per unit volume, and the results are plotted as panels 1A to 1C.

結果呈現,作用濃度為0.1%以及1%的羥丙基-β-環糊精的組別,不論是作用1分鐘或是6小時,均可抑制細菌的生長。然而,若是濃度提升至10%時,反而會促進肺炎雷伯氏菌的生長(47x10 5cfu/mL)。也就是,需將環糊精控制於適當的濃度下,方具有抑制口腔細菌生長的效果。 The results showed that the groups of 0.1% and 1% h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in could inhibit the growth of bacteria regardless of whether they were used for 1 minute or 6 hours. However, when the concentration was increased to 10%, the growth of L. pneumoniae was promoted instead (47x10 5 cfu/mL). That is, the cyclodextrin needs to be controlled at an appropriate concentration to have the effect of inhibiting the growth of oral bacteria.

進一步地,將羥丙基-β-環糊精的抑菌力 (%) 定義為(控制組的菌量-實驗組的菌量)/控制組的菌量,並換算出第1A圖至第1C圖中的0.1%以及1%羥丙基-β-環糊精對於各組細菌的抑菌力,繪製為第2A圖以及第2B圖。Further, the bacteriostatic power (%) of h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in is defined as (the amount of bacteria in the control group-the amount of bacteria in the experimental group)/the amount of bacteria in the control group, and converts from Figure 1A to Figure 1. The bacteriostatic activity of 0.1% and 1% h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in in Figure 1C against each group of bacteria is plotted as Figure 2A and Figure 2B.

結果呈現,大體而言,1%羥丙基-β-環糊精具有較佳的抑菌力,並且在作用1分鐘時,即可達到同時抑制三種細菌生長的效果。此外,隨著作用時間的提升,對於部分細菌的抑菌力也隨之提升。The results showed that, in general, 1% h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in had better bacteriostatic activity, and the effect of inhibiting the growth of three kinds of bacteria could be achieved at the same time after acting for 1 minute. In addition, as the working time increases, the bacteriostatic power to some bacteria also increases.

實施例二、環糊精的清潔試驗Embodiment 2, the cleaning test of cyclodextrin

為測試使用含有羥丙基-β-環糊精的清潔液,移除口腔菌的清潔效果,使用培養管分別培養大腸桿菌、黴菌/酵母菌混合液兩天後,倒掉菌液。接著,使用棉花棒塗抹管壁,使用食品法規範之測試片(JNC SK Neofilm TW微生物快檢片)檢測棉花棒所沾取到的菌量,其中大腸桿菌使用JNC大腸桿菌/大腸桿菌群測試片(型號#6635)檢測,黴菌/酵母菌則使用JNC酵母菌與黴菌測試片(型號#6640)檢測,計算獲得各組初始菌量均為1x10 4cfu/mL。接著,倒入清洗液,搖晃1分鐘後,倒掉清洗液,其中清洗液包含三組,分別為含有1%的25°C環糊精水溶液、65°C的逆滲透熱水、以及25°C的逆滲透常溫水。接著,再度以棉花棒塗抹管壁,培養棉花棒所沾取到的菌兩天,再度使用食品法規範之測試片計算菌量,結果呈現於下表1。 In order to test the cleaning effect of removing oral bacteria by using a cleaning solution containing h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in, E. coli and the mixture of mold/yeast were cultured in culture tubes for two days, and then the bacteria solution was discarded. Next, use a cotton swab to smear the wall of the tube, and use a test piece (JNC SK Neofilm TW microbiological quick test piece) to detect the amount of bacteria on the cotton swab. The E. coli uses the JNC E. coli/Escherichia coli test piece. (Model #6635) was used to detect mold/yeast, and JNC yeast and mold test strips (Model #6640) were used to detect mold/yeast, and the initial bacterial volume of each group was calculated to be 1×10 4 cfu/mL. Then, pour in the cleaning solution, shake for 1 minute, then pour out the cleaning solution, wherein the cleaning solution includes three groups, which are 1% 25°C cyclodextrin aqueous solution, 65°C reverse osmosis hot water, and 25°C cyclodextrin solution. C of reverse osmosis room temperature water. Next, smear the wall of the tube with a cotton swab again, cultivate the bacteria on the cotton swab for two days, and use the test piece regulated by the Food Law to calculate the amount of bacteria again. The results are shown in Table 1 below.

表1、環糊精的清潔效果比較表          清潔液   菌種 環糊精水溶液 65°C的逆滲透熱水 25°C的逆滲透常溫水 大腸桿菌 清洗後菌量 (cfu/mL) 0 2.0x10 1 過多無法計算 抑制率(%) 100 99.8 過低難以評估 黴菌/酵母菌混合液 清洗後菌量 (cfu/mL) 0 0 8.0x10 1 抑制率(%) 100 100 99.2% Table 1. Comparison table of cleaning effect of cyclodextrin cleaning solution bacteria Cyclodextrin aqueous solution 65°C reverse osmosis hot water 25°C reverse osmosis room temperature water Escherichia coli The amount of bacteria after cleaning (cfu/mL) 0 2.0x10 1 too much to calculate Inhibition rate(%) 100 99.8 too low to assess Mold/yeast mix The amount of bacteria after cleaning (cfu/mL) 0 0 8.0x10 1 Inhibition rate(%) 100 100 99.2%

表1結果呈現,使用環糊精水溶液作為清潔液,經過沖洗培養管步驟模擬漱口流程,則環糊精水溶液相較於65°C或25°C的逆滲透水,可以達到更好的細菌以及真菌的移除效果,具有較佳的清潔作用。The results in Table 1 show that using the cyclodextrin aqueous solution as the cleaning solution and simulating the mouthwash process by rinsing the culture tube, the cyclodextrin aqueous solution can achieve better bacteria than reverse osmosis water at 65°C or 25°C. As well as the removal of fungi, it has a better cleaning effect.

實施例三、含環糊精的漱口水Embodiment 3. Mouthwash containing cyclodextrin

為進一步確認含環糊精的口腔護理用品的實際使用情形,將環糊精添加天然物成分,配製為濃縮漱口水 (配方包含47.5%羥丙基-β-環糊精、3.5%丙二醇、3.5%天然薄荷腦、1.0%乳酸薄荷酯、4.5%甘草二鉀、以及水)後,分別進行穩定性以及稀釋後的使用感受問卷調查。In order to further confirm the actual use of oral care products containing cyclodextrin, cyclodextrin was added with natural ingredients to prepare a concentrated mouthwash (the formula contains 47.5% h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in, 3.5% propylene glycol, 3.5 % natural menthol, 1.0% menthyl lactate, 4.5% dipotassium licorice, and water), respectively, conduct stability and diluted use experience questionnaires.

實施例三.1、濃縮漱口水的穩定性測試Embodiment three.1, the stability test of concentrated mouthwash

將濃縮漱口水分別放置於室溫/12個月、30°C/12個月、以及30°C/12個月,再觀測濃縮漱口水的外觀、氣味、內容物含量以及微生物的產生 (偵測是否產生真菌、黴菌、大腸桿菌、綠膿桿菌 ( Pseudomonas aeruginosa)、或金黃色葡萄球菌,其中偵測下限為10cfu/g),結果請見表2。 Place the concentrated mouthwash at room temperature/12 months, 30°C/12 months, and 30°C/12 months, and then observe the appearance, smell, content of the concentrated mouthwash and the production of microorganisms (detection). Detect whether fungus, mold, Escherichia coli, Pseudomonas aeruginosa ( Pseudomonas aeruginosa ), or Staphylococcus aureus are produced, wherein the detection limit is 10cfu/g), the results are shown in Table 2.

表2、濃縮漱口水的穩定性結果統整表 保存條件 室溫/ 12個月 30°C/ 12個月 45°C/ 6個月 外觀 透明澄清 透明澄清 透明澄清 無色 無色 極淡黃色 味道 無異常 無異常 無異常 內容物含量 合格 合格 合格 微生物 (偵測下限<10 cfu/g) Table 2. Consolidated Table of Stability Results of Concentrated Mouthwash Storage Conditions room temperature / 12 months 30°C/ 12 months 45°C/ 6 months Exterior Transparent and clear Transparent and clear Transparent and clear colorless colorless very pale yellow smell No abnormality No abnormality No abnormality Content content qualified qualified qualified Microorganisms (lower detection limit <10 cfu/g) none none none

結果呈現,在45°C下,濃縮漱口水可至少保存6個月不變質,並且在室溫以及30°C下,至少可保存12個月不變質。The results show that the concentrated mouthwash can be stored without deterioration for at least 6 months at 45°C, and at least 12 months at room temperature and 30°C.

實施例三.2、濃縮漱口水的使用感受問卷調查Example 3.2. Questionnaire on the use of concentrated mouthwash

徵求受測者共13位,經水漱口後,分別使用測試組(將實施例二之濃縮漱口水以水稀釋為羥丙基-β-環糊精為1%之漱口水)以及市售品 (李施德霖薄荷除菌漱口水)漱口,接著填寫使用者感受問卷。受試者依感受的強烈度由1至5評分。例如刺激感評分為5,表示刺激性高,評分為1,表示刺激性低;清涼持久度評分為5,表示持久時間長,評分為1,表示持久時間短;清爽感評分為5,表示清爽性高,評分為1,表示清爽性低。接著,以統計分析檢測市售品與測試品間的給分平均值是否具顯著差異。最後,將問卷結果整理為表3至表5。A total of 13 subjects were asked, after gargling with water, the test group (the concentrated mouthwash of Example 2 was diluted with water to obtain a 1% hydroxypropyl-β-cyclodextrin mouthwash) and the commercially available Rinse the mouth with the product (Listerine Mint Antibacterial Mouthwash), and then fill out a user experience questionnaire. Subjects rated the intensity of the sensation on a scale of 1 to 5. For example, if the irritation score is 5, it means that the irritation is high, and the score is 1, which means the irritation is low; the coolness lasting score is 5, which means the lasting time is long, and the score is 1, which means the lasting time is short; the refreshing feeling score is 5, which means refreshing High sex, a score of 1, indicating low freshness. Next, statistical analysis was used to detect whether there was a significant difference in the average value of the scores between the commercial product and the test product. Finally, the questionnaire results are organized into Tables 3 to 5.

結果顯示,市售品與測試品在刺激性具有顯著差異,而清涼持久度以及清爽感則無顯著差異。本揭示內容實施例之測試品的口感,較市售品溫和無負擔。The results show that there is a significant difference in irritation between the commercial product and the test product, but there is no significant difference in cooling lasting and refreshing feeling. The taste of the test products of the embodiments of the present disclosure is milder and less burdensome than the commercial products.

本揭示內容的一些實施方式所提供的環糊精用於抑制口腔細菌生長的用途,首度將環糊精做為口腔保健的功能活性成分,不須使用常規上對身體細胞具有高刺激性的殺菌劑,即可抑制細菌的生長,避免生物膜的生成以及細菌產生抗藥性的風險,還具有極佳的移除細菌以及真菌的效果,並且不需使用防腐劑,即可達到至少一年的保存期限。此外,環糊精的口感溫和,可溶於水,因此,所配製而成的口腔護理用品對口腔黏膜不具有刺激性,可提升使用者的使用意願。The use of cyclodextrin for inhibiting the growth of oral bacteria provided by some embodiments of the present disclosure is the first time that cyclodextrin is used as a functional active ingredient for oral health care, without the need to use conventionally highly irritating body cells. Fungicides, which inhibit the growth of bacteria, avoid the formation of biofilms and the risk of bacterial resistance, have excellent removal of bacteria and fungi, and can achieve a minimum of one year without the use of preservatives. Shelf life. In addition, the cyclodextrin has a mild taste and is soluble in water. Therefore, the prepared oral care product is not irritating to the oral mucosa, which can improve the user's willingness to use.

此外,環糊精與其他功能活性成分還具有協同作用,環糊精可利用自身結構上兩性分子的助溶特性,增加功能活性成分的溶解度上限,進一步地增進功能活性成分所對應的醫療效用或是生理活性。In addition, cyclodextrin also has a synergistic effect with other functional active ingredients. Cyclodextrin can use the co-solubilization properties of amphiphilic molecules on its own structure to increase the upper limit of solubility of functional active ingredients, and further enhance the corresponding medical effects of functional active ingredients or is physiological activity.
